Cybersecurity Awareness Month
Each and every one of us needs to do our part to make sure that our online lives are kept safe and secure. That’s what Cybersecurity Awareness Month – observed in October – is all about!
Data Privacy Week
Millions of people are unaware of and uninformed about how their personal information is being used, collected or shared in our digital society. Data Privacy Week aims to empower individuals and companies to protect their data

HBCU Cybersecurity Career Program
See Yourself in Cyber equips HBCU students with the necessary life and career navigation skills to help them find, and succeed in, roles in security, privacy, and risk.
CyberSecure My Business™
CyberSecure My Business™ is a program teaching small and medium-sized business (SMB) owners and leaders to manage cyber risk.
Identity Management Day
Identity Management Day educates business leaders and IT decision makers on the importance of identity management and key components including governance, identity-centric security best practices, processes, and technology.
